发布于 2025-01-11 05:59:22 · 阅读量: 105470
在加密货币交易领域,自动化交易越来越成为投资者提高交易效率、减少人工干预的重要手段。对于许多活跃的交易者来说,能够通过API接口来进行自动化交易,不仅能够实现24/7不间断的交易,还能根据市场波动及时调整策略。Bitget,作为一个知名的加密货币交易平台,也为用户提供了相应的API接口,那么,Bitget是否支持API接口,且是否适合自动化交易呢?
Bitget 提供了强大的 API 接口,允许用户通过编程的方式与平台进行交互,实现交易自动化。通过这些API,用户能够进行市场数据查询、下单、获取账户信息等操作。API接口支持RESTful API和WebSocket协议,适用于各种编程语言,包括Python、Java、Node.js等,方便不同技术背景的开发者进行集成和操作。
账户管理
通过 API,用户可以查看账户的余额、交易历史等信息,实时掌握自己的资金情况。
市场数据查询
Bitget 提供了实时的市场行情数据接口,包括最新的价格、深度数据、成交量等,帮助用户做出及时的交易决策。
下单与撤单
用户可以通过 API 提交买入或卖出的请求,支持限价单、市场单等多种订单类型。此外,还可以实现订单的撤销和查询。
资金划转
Bitget API 允许用户在不同账户之间进行资金划转,比如从现货账户转到合约账户或反之,方便管理资金。
K线数据和历史交易数据
API 还可以获取历史的K线数据,帮助用户分析市场走势,制定交易策略。
Bitget 的 API 接口在自动化交易方面的功能非常强大,特别适合那些想要通过编程实现交易策略的用户。用户可以使用API将自己的交易策略自动化执行,实现无人值守的交易操作。
通过Bitget提供的API,交易者可以:
创建 API 密钥
在 Bitget 平台,用户首先需要登录自己的账户,进入个人中心的API管理界面。通过创建API密钥,用户将获得一个独特的API Key和Secret,这两项信息是用来在程序中访问API的凭证。
选择合适的开发语言
Bitget的API支持多种开发语言,常见的有Python、Java、Node.js等。用户可以根据自己的编程能力选择合适的语言进行开发。
调用API接口
使用API密钥后,用户可以通过HTTP请求的方式调用Bitget的API接口。比如,通过发送GET请求获取市场数据,或POST请求提交交易订单。
监控与调试
在自动化交易过程中,用户需要时刻监控交易机器人的运行状态。通过API提供的实时数据和日志,开发者可以及时发现并解决可能出现的问题。
虽然 Bitget 提供了强大的API功能,但在使用API进行自动化交易时,安全性始终是一个需要关注的重点。以下是一些建议:
Bitget提供的API接口为用户自动化交易提供了极大的便利,功能完备、灵活性高,非常适合那些需要高效交易、想要进行策略开发的用户。通过API接口,投资者不仅可以提高交易速度和准确度,还可以降低情绪波动对交易的影响。然而,使用API进行自动化交易时,用户需要特别注意安全性,避免因为操作不当导致资产损失。